A sportsbook is an establishment that accepts bets on various sports events. It is a gambling establishment, which means that it involves a risk of losing money, and is often illegal in some states. However, sportsbooks are becoming more popular as states legalize them and make it easier for people to access them online. In addition to betting, a sportsbook also offers information about the different teams and players. This allows bettors to place more informed bets.
A common mistake that sportsbooks make is failing to include a robust verification process. This is one of the most important parts of the sportsbook, and it is essential to ensure that it is easy for users to sign up and verify their identity. This is important to reduce fraud and keep the betting experience as seamless as possible.
Another mistake that sportsbooks make is not including a rewards system in their product. This is a great way to encourage users to continue using the sportsbook, and it can also help drive traffic and scale the business. However, it is important to understand that implementing a rewards system can be a complex task and requires a lot of work.
If you are launching a sportsbook, it is essential to know your competition. This will allow you to create a unique offering that sets you apart from the rest. This will attract new customers and ensure that existing ones are retained. In addition, it will also enable you to identify ways to improve your own offerings.
You should also consider the type of sports and events that your sportsbook will offer. Ensure that you have enough coverage of the major leagues to appeal to a wide range of users. It is also a good idea to have live streams of games and events. This will give users the opportunity to watch their favorite teams and increase engagement with your brand.
Another thing that you should consider is the risk management of your sportsbook. This is an important part of the sportsbook, and it should be integrated with data to balance the stakes and liability of each outcome. Your providers should provide you with clear documentation so that integrating the data into your sportsbook is simple and cost-effective.
Lastly, you should ensure that your sportsbook has a comprehensive and accurate listing of all events and teams. This will allow your users to find the exact event they want to bet on and will ensure that they have a positive experience with your sportsbook.
If you are launching a sportsbook, the last thing that you want to do is have a slow and unresponsive app. This will turn off your users and may cause them to look for a better option. To avoid this, you should choose a provider that uses an API that is fast and easy to integrate with your system. You should also use a multi-layer validation to prevent security breaches. This will protect your data from hackers and other potential threats.